Rossignol Gala Snowboard - Women's 2021

Who said learning to ride had to be hard work? The Rossignol Gala Snowboard gets you going with Amptek Auto Turn Rocker for easygoing, catch free carves and a soft flex profile that keeps the board nice and maneuverable at low speeds. The full wood core offers plenty of pop, energy, and stability, and it has plenty under the hood to keep up as you ease into bigger terrain. Product Details

Rocker Type:
AmpTek Auto Turn Rocker: Amptek Auto Turn has an 80/20, rocker/camber blend for effortless turn initiation and an easy playful ride.
Flex:
Flex Rating: 3 (1 Soft - 10 Stiff): A soft, forgiving flex ideal for progressing riders.
Directional All-Mountain Flex: Rossignol's Directional All-Mountain Flex profile is stiff under the back foot for control with a stiff waist for stability at high speed. A softer flex under the front foot ensures easier turns and maneuverability.
Core:
Wood Core: Rossignol's standard wood core delivers the utmost durability and performance. All are built using sustainably harvested wood, from responsibly managed forests.
Laminates:
Glass Fiber: Delivers customized flex with increased torsional resistance and stability.
Sidewalls:
ABS Sidewalls: ABS provides enhanced durability while keeping the core safe from moisture.
Base:
Extruded 1320
Binding Compatibility:
4 x 4 Insert Pattern
